TICKET-4471: Expired credentials blocking undo/redo history service

For weekly sync: undo and redo in SketchLoom's diagram editor are broken on staging. The history microservice (Chronicler) rejects all writes — its service credential expired Tuesday. Undo stack persists locally but redo across sessions fails silently. Rotation done, pipeline redeploy pending. No user data loss. Fix ETA: before Thursday demo. Updated Chronicler key for staging is below.

app token of kawif-yafop = zpat2_88

Plugin authors hitting 429s from the Larkspur gateway: quotas are enforced per tenant, not per plugin instance, so fan-out workers share one bucket. Please implement exponential backoff and honor the retry-after header rather than hammering the endpoint. Requests beyond burst are queued briefly, then rejected. The current defaults are as follows.

tuning table, faduf-baduf:
PRIORITIES = {
    "ulavan": 191,
    "silys": 750,
    "goriel": 238,
    "kelmir": 66,
    "wendor": 432,
}

// Connection pooling for the Varnholt data layer.
// Plugin authors: do not open raw connections to the Quillstore cluster.
// Always acquire handles through this client, which maintains a bounded
// pool (default 12, configurable via pool_max). Idle connections are
// recycled after 90 seconds; long-running transactions should request a
// pinned handle instead. The client authenticates against the internal
// Quillstore broker using the key shown on the next line.

gateway credential: kto23_LX9A4ys6i4nzHtpOLNLodKK

## Tax-rate lookup cache (Ledgerly)

The cache fronts the Ravenshaw rate tables. TTL is 6h; stale reads are acceptable per finance. Invalidation runs nightly via `ratecache flush`. Never bypass the cache in prod — the upstream lookup service rate-limits hard and a cache miss storm took us down once already. Config lives in `.env.ratecache`: set `RATECACHE_TTL_SECONDS` and `RATECACHE_REGION`. The upstream lookup service also requires an access credential, which goes on the line immediately after this sentence:

env line for bageg-yahog: RELAY_SECRET13=e7aee444c36a0